Liabilities and suits as affected by change of name or location
12 U.S.C. § 32

Text
Nothing contained in sections 30 and 31 of this title shall be so construed as in any manner to release any national banking association under its old name or at its old location from any liability, or affect any action or proceeding in law in which said association may be or become a party or interested.
